Failed findings
-
Cooling Heating and Holding Capacities-Equipment (Pf)Inspector note: Establishment has added to menu offerings and removed a basement walkin out of service. Repair walkin to sustain ample refrigeration. Current walkin is over capacitized. Provide additional refrigeration as needed.
-
Nonfood-Contact Surfaces (C)Inspector note: Juice bar built with shoddy construction and exposed wood and crevices in several areas. Establishment must obtain proper permits from building department.
-
System Maintained in Good Repair (C)Inspector note: Frozen yogurt/ice cream machine is hard plumbed into shared drain with handsink. Provide properly plumbed air gap. Unit out of use until properly plumbed. • Juice bar with handsink and no dump sink. Provide dump sink.
